Speaking of the holidays, the ever-popular Mickey’s Very Merry Christmas Party will be returning on select nights at Magic Kingdom from November 8 to December 22, 2026, and Jollywood Nights will be returning to Hollywood Studios on select nights, November 7, 2026 – January 5, 2027! Guests staying at select Walt Disney World Resort hotels, the Walt Disney World Swan and Dolphin Hotels, or Shades of Green can purchase tickets beginning July 9. Tickets will open to all other guests on July 16. These popular events often sell out, so planning ahead is a great idea!

In case you missed it, Disney Cruise Line recently revised guest policies on the following:

  • Guests ages 21 and older may bring onboard either one unopened bottle of wine or champagne (up to 750 ml) or six beers (up to 12 oz. each) at embarkation. All alcohol must be carried onboard in carry-on luggage.
  • The dining room corkage fee has been reduced to $20 per bottle.
  • Selfie sticks, handheld extension poles, and tripods are now permitted onboard when folded and under 18 inches in length. Larger items must remain stored in guests’ staterooms and may only be used ashore.
  • Decorations can be placed on stateroom doors only and not on hallway walls or ceilings. All decorations must follow existing guidelines.
